#998471 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#998471 is composed of 60% red, 51.8%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.7% magenta, 26.1%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 28.5 degrees, a saturation of 16.4% and a lightness of 52.2%. #998471 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e2 with #330900.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#998471 color description : Mostly desaturated dark orange.

#998471 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#998471 has RGB values of R:153, G:132,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.26,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10060913.

Shades and Tints of #998471

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060505 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#998471

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868584 is the less saturated color, while #f77f13 is the most saturated one.
